Vespa product recalled over injury risk

Recall date
February 4, 2015
Source
National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A)
Official notice title
Piaggio Group Americas, Inc. recalls 2008–2011 Vespa, Piaggio — 12 models
Recall number
15V066000
Brand / firm
Vespa, Piaggio
Sold / distributed
Potentially affected: 2,613 units

Why it was recalled

If the motorcycle stalls, there is an increased risk of a crash.

What was recalled

Piaggio Group Americas Inc. (Piaggio) is recalling certain model year 2008-2010 Vespa GTS 250, GTV 250, GTS Super 250, 2011 Vespa LX 150, LXV 150, S 150, 2010-2011 Vespa GTS 300, GTV 300, GTS Super 300, 2009-2010 Piaggio MP3 250, BV 250 Tourer, and 2010 BV 300 Tourer motorcycles. Due to a defective fuel pump, the affected motorcycles may stall while being operated or may fail to restart after being shut off for 15-20 minutes.

What to do

Piaggio will notify owners, and dealers will replace the defective fuel pump, free of charge. The recall began March 16, 2015. Owners may contact Piaggio customer service at 1-212-380-4433.. Follow the official notice for full instructions.
